People who should purchase special needs equipment for children are those whose children suffer from certain disorders. These can range from self-abuse to hemophilia. You may also want to consider a helmet for a child who has cerebral palsy because they have problems with motor control and may injure their heads during a fall. They are also beneficial for children and adults who have suffered from certain head injuries.
Would a head injury require Special Needs Equipment for Children
If your child has received an injury that actually fractured part of the skull, then you should consult your doctor about using a helmet as part of the special needs equipment. For children who have this type of injury, a helmet can help prevent further damage. It can also protect the skull during the healing process when the bone may be softer and more likely to crack or fracture.
